What is recorded here
In rough grazing, c. 10m W of another fulacht fiadh (CO071-140---). Grass-covered spread of burnt material (L c. 9m; Wth c. 5m); ground immediately to N is waterlogged.
The above description is derived from the published 'Archaeological Inventory of County Cork. Volume 3: Mid Cork' (Dublin: Stationery Office, 1997). In certain instances the entries have been revised and updated in the light of recent research.
